Avocado: Source of Healthy Fats and Essential Nutrients

Avocado, also known as the palm, stands out for its content of monounsaturated fats, which are considered very beneficial for cardiovascular health. These fats can increase levels HDL cholesterol (known as “good” cholesterol) and reduce LDL (“bad”) cholesterol levels.

But the benefits of avocados go beyond healthy fats. This fruit is an excellent source of essential nutrients such as vitamin E, vitamin C, vitamin K, folic acid, and potassium. These nutrients not only promote cardiovascular health, but can also help promote weight loss.

Ideas to include avocados in your diet

How can you use all the benefits of avocados in your daily diet? Here are some ideas:

Sliced: Cut the avocado into slices or cubes and add it to salads, sandwiches or rolls. You can season with a little salt and pepper, or add a squeeze of lemon to intensify the flavor.

On toast: Spread slices of toasted bread with avocado and add additional ingredients such as tomatoes, fresh cheese, scrambled eggs or smoked salmon. Let your creativity run wild and combine it with your favorite ingredients.

In shakes or smoothies: Add avocado to your shakes or smoothies for a creamy texture and extra nutrients. Mix it with fruits like banana, spinach, mango or pineapple and add liquids like almond milk or yogurt for a tasty and healthy drink.

As a filler: Avocados are a great topping for tacos, burritos, or quesadillas. Pair it with proteins like chicken, shrimp or tofu and add other ingredients like tomatoes, lettuce, onions or cheese to make a delicious and nutritious meal.

in desserts: Although not a very common option, avocados can also be used in desserts. Make an avocado mousse or add the fruit to cakes or tarts for a smooth, creamy texture.
